Job Description:

What will you work on?
The Director, Marketing & Franchise Operations is the operational backbone for Spin Master's key franchises. This role is responsible for providing the operational calendar, project management, and cross-functional leadership required to bring the global creative, franchise and licensing plans to life. Acting as the central hub for all creative,  franchise and licensing-out activities, this individual will partner closely with the franchise, creative and category leads to drive executional excellence, ensure seamless communication, and manage the operating rhythm of the team. The ideal candidate is a master organizer and communicator with a passion for building processes that enable creative and commercial success at Spin Master, Inc.
 

Operational Planning & Execution:

  • Partner with franchise, creative and category leadership to support planning processes by providing operational oversight and managing key deliverables.
  • Translate high-level franchise strategies and go-to-market roadmap into actionable project plans, timelines, and budgets for all cross-functional teams.
  • Establish and manage the operating rhythm for the franchise, creative and category management team, including planning calendars, key milestone tracking, and meeting cadences.
  • Develop and implement standardized processes and tools (e.g., project trackers, asset management systems, approval workflows) to drive efficiency and operational excellence.
  • Proactively identify and resolve operational bottlenecks, ensuring initiatives remain on schedule and within budget.

Cross-Functional Alignment & Communication:

  • Act as the central operational hub and primary point of contact for franchise, creative and category management-related activities, ensuring clear communication between Content, Consumer Products, Sales, Global Brand, Marketing, and International teams.
  • Lead cross-functional team meetings to ensure all stakeholders are aligned on priorities, timelines, and responsibilities.
  • Manage the creation and distribution of core franchise, creative and licensing plan materials, including brand guidelines, planning calendars, licensing go-to-market and asset toolkits, ensuring all teams have the information they need to execute.
  • Oversee the approvals process for creative and franchise marketing materials, ensuring brand consistency and timely feedback.

Franchise, Creative and Category Management Operations:

  • Manage budgets, including tracking invoices and providing regular financial updates to leadership.
  • Support the execution of global franchise and licensing plans by managing project timelines, coordinating asset delivery, and ensuring team alignment.
  • Coordinate the gathering of market analysis, competitive research, and consumer insights to support the strategic planning process.
  • Prepare and present regular updates on operational performance, project status, and key marketing metrics to department leaders.

What are your skills and experience?

  • 8+ years of experience in a brand operations, marketing operations, project management, or franchise management role, preferably within the entertainment, toy, or consumer products industry.
  • Exceptional project management and organizational skills, with a proven ability to manage multiple complex projects simultaneously in a fast-paced environment.
  • Demonstrated experience in developing and implementing operational processes and tools to improve team efficiency and effectiveness.
  • Superb communication and interpersonal skills, with a talent for building consensus and driving alignment across diverse, cross-functional teams.
  • A strategic thinker with an operational mindset; able to understand the big picture and master the details required to get there.
  • Experience managing budgets and complex project schedules.

What We Do

Spin Master Corp. (TSX:TOY) is a leading global children's entertainment company creating exceptional play experiences through a diverse portfolio of innovative toys, entertainment franchises and digital games. Spin Master is best known for award-winning brands PAW Patrol®, Bakugan®, Kinetic Sand®, Air Hogs®, Hatchimals® and GUND®, and is the toy licensee for other popular properties. Spin Master Entertainment creates and produces compelling multiplatform content, stories and endearing characters through its in-house studio and partnerships with outside creators, including the preschool success PAW Patrol and 10 other television series, which are distributed in more than 160 countries. The Company has an established digital presence anchored by the Toca Boca® and Sago Mini® brands, which combined have more than 25 million monthly active users. With over 1,800 employees in 28 offices globally, Spin Master distributes products in more than 100 countries.
